English Foxhound

Breed History:

The English Foxhound originated in England during the 16th century and is one of the oldest and most respected hunting hound breeds. Developed by crossing various scent hounds, including the Talbot Hound, Greyhounds, and Bulldogs, the breed was selectively refined for fox hunting on horseback. Breeders focused on creating a dog with exceptional stamina, speed, a keen sense of smell, and the ability to work cooperatively in large packs over long distances.

For centuries, the English Foxhound has been a cornerstone of traditional British fox hunting. Its athleticism, endurance, and even temperament have also made it a capable companion for active owners, although it remains primarily valued as a working scent hound.

Today, the English Foxhound is admired as a loyal family companion, exceptional hunting dog, and versatile scent hound known for its endurance, intelligence, and remarkable tracking ability.

Gender

Height

Weight

Male

58–64 cm

29–34 kg

Female

58–64 cm

25–32 kg

Size – Large

Life Expectancy: 10–13 years

Breed Appearance:

The English Foxhound is a powerful, athletic, and well-balanced dog built for speed and endurance.

The breed commonly features:

  • Broad, slightly domed head
  • Long, square muzzle
  • Large, brown or hazel eyes
  • Long, pendant ears
  • Deep, broad chest
  • Strong, muscular neck
  • Long, straight limbs
  • Long tail carried high with a slight curve

Its short, dense coat is smooth, hard, and weather-resistant.

Common coat colours include:

  • Tricolour (black, white, and tan)
  • Lemon and white
  • Red and white
  • Black and white
  • Tan and white

Nearly all recognised hound colour combinations are accepted.

The breed's muscular frame and balanced proportions reflect its heritage as an endurance hunting hound.

Breed Type – Scent Hound:

The English Foxhound is an intelligent, energetic, and determined scent hound.

It is known for being:

  • Loyal
  • Friendly
  • Intelligent
  • Energetic
  • Independent
  • Sociable

The breed forms strong bonds with its family and generally gets along well with children and other dogs. It has a strong prey drive and thrives when given opportunities to use its natural scenting instincts.

Training:

The English Foxhound is intelligent but can be independent because of its hunting background.

Training should focus on:

  • Early socialisation
  • Positive reinforcement methods
  • Basic obedience training
  • Reliable recall training
  • Leash manners
  • Scent-based enrichment activities

The breed excels in:

  • Tracking
  • Scent work
  • Hunting trials
  • Search and rescue
  • Canicross
  • Obedience

Consistent, reward-based training helps channel the breed's intelligence while reinforcing responsiveness.

Health & Care:

The English Foxhound is generally healthy but may be prone to several health concerns, including:

  • Hip dysplasia
  • Elbow dysplasia
  • Obesity
  • Gastric dilatation-volvulus (bloat)
  • Ear infections
  • Progressive retinal atrophy

Routine veterinary care, responsible breeding, regular exercise, and maintaining a healthy weight help support long-term health.

Living Conditions:

The English Foxhound thrives in homes where it has plenty of room to exercise and explore.

Ideal environments include:

  • Houses with large, securely fenced yards
  • Rural or suburban homes
  • Active families
  • Experienced dog owners
  • Homes with access to trails, parks, or open countryside

The breed prefers living indoors with its family but is not well suited to apartment living due to its high energy level and loud baying.

Exercise:

The English Foxhound has high exercise requirements.

Recommended activities include:

  • Long daily walks
  • Running
  • Hiking
  • Tracking games
  • Scent work
  • Mental enrichment activities

Regular physical activity and scent-based challenges are essential to maintain the breed's physical and mental well-being.

Grooming:

The short coat requires minimal maintenance.

  • Brushing once per week
  • Occasional bathing
  • Regular ear cleaning
  • Nail trimming
  • Routine dental care

The breed sheds moderately throughout the year.

Advantages:

  • Loyal and affectionate family companion
  • Outstanding scent-tracking and hunting abilities
  • Friendly with children and other dogs
  • Athletic and highly energetic
  • Low grooming requirements
  • Hardy and generally healthy breed

Disadvantages:

  • Requires extensive daily exercise and mental stimulation
  • Strong prey drive may lead to chasing small animals
  • Can be stubborn and independent during training
  • Loud baying may not suit urban environments
  • Not well suited to apartment living
  • May become destructive or vocal if bored or under-exercised
